CNN 中的“补丁”是什么?

机器算法验证 神经网络 术语 卷积神经网络
2022-03-22 09:06:50

通过阅读,“补丁”似乎是 CNN 输入图像的一部分,但它到底是什么?使用 CNN 解决问题时,“补丁”何时发挥作用?为什么我们需要“补丁”?“补丁”和内核(即特征检测器)之间的关系是什么?

如果您能系统地回答所有这些问题,我将不胜感激。

1个回答

通过阅读,“补丁”似乎是 CNN 输入图像的一部分,但它到底是什么?

正是你所描述的。内核(或过滤器或特征检测器)一次只查看图像的一个块,然后过滤器移动到图像的另一块,依此类推。

使用 CNN 解决问题时,“补丁”何时发挥作用?

当您将 CNN 过滤器应用于图像时,它一次只查看一个补丁。

为什么我们需要“补丁”?

CNN 内核/过滤器一次只处理一个补丁,而不是整个图像。这是因为我们希望过滤器处理图像的小块以检测特征(边缘等)。这也有一个很好的正则化属性,因为我们估计的参数数量较少,并且这些参数必须在每个图像的许多区域以及所有其他训练图像的许多区域中都是“好的”。

“补丁”和内核(即特征检测器)之间的关系是什么?

补丁是内核的输入。